Mr. Lucky is the result of an instrumental artistic accident. It was inspired through seven scratch tracks of piano tunes by Johnny Davidson (My Cousin Troy) recorded by Shawn (Mudfish) Delaney at the Nine Fire Studio in East Atlanta. Out of pure inspiration, Chris Reeves tracked live drums in his own studio (Atlanta Drum Works), and critics who heard the results persuaded them to push the project forward. After setting up camp at Nine Fire and bringing Kevin Vines (Bass) into the mix, Mr. Lucky was born. The debut album, "Try it out before you thank me", is an artistic collaboration of inspirations that ensued between 2006 and 2008. As the collaboration developed, it expanded to feature reputable guest musicians Abel Melody, Christopher Delaney, Danny Paschal, Jim Coley, and Mike Delaney. The music is an optimistic celebration dedicated to musicianship, dance, art, love, and everyday life in Atlanta, Georgia. It's about making a living, risking everything, assimilating creative ambition, and washing away the dust of everyday life.
